ABOUT THE ROLE
Location: Williamsburg Shop
Status: Part-Time
Compensation: $18.00/ hour + Commission(s)* & Tip eligibility
Position Summary:
The Kith - Treats Counter Associate is the face of the Kith Treats shop. They are personable, friendly, and focused on delivering a first in class experience to all new and returning Kith-Treats customers. They are passionate about desserts and committed to delivering a best-in-class experience capped off with a beautifully assembled TREAT!
RESPONSIBILITIES
Primary Responsibilities:
Continuously providing an exceptional experience for each of our Treats customers, capped off with a visually captivating and equally delicious dessert.
Practicing and mastering the plating & presentation techniques used on each one of our creations.
Clean and maintain industrial kitchen equipment.
Using time between customers to manage inventory levels, to ensure we are always prepared.
Applying our iconic “Swirl” to our highly sought-after desserts.
Proactively communicating inventory needs with management.
Remaining updated on all company activations, as well as any brand partnerships.
Adhere to all company processes, policies, and procedures.
Follow all Food & Safety processes, policies, and procedures.
Adhere to availability and scheduling needs of the business.
Assist Shops Management team with housekeeping responsibilities, which include but not limited to, dusting, sweeping, collecting trash, and other tasks traditionally associated with standard food & beverage operations.
Special Projects:
Participate and assist in Physical Inventories as required by the business.
Assist Merchandising team during visual initiatives as required by the business.
REQUIREMENTS
Availability:
Open & flexible availability, including but not limited to evenings, overnights, and weekends as well as Holidays.
Availability to consistently work weekends, special projects, drops/releases or as the business’ needs require.
License(s)/Certificate(s):
Valid (Inset applicable F&B lic/cert and alcohol lic/cert if applicable) or equivalent.
Experience:
1-2 years in a food/beverage position
1+ years in a customer facing position is preferred
1+ years of cash handling is preferred
Skills/Abilities:
Ability to perform business math
Ability to multi-task
Efficient communication
Ability to lift and move 30lbs.
Ability to perform standard tasks that are related to retail operations including but not limited to, bending, twisting, and climbing ladders/step stools.
Ability to stand and walk for prolonged periods of time.
